What Is Freight Management Software?

Freight management software (FMS) is a digital tool that helps you plan, execute, and optimize the movement of goods across your supply chain. It brings together shipment planning, carrier selection, real-time tracking, documentation, billing, and reporting so you can manage freight from origin to destination with greater control and transparency.

You can think of FMS as the central nervous system for transportation operations. Instead of juggling spreadsheets, phone calls, and multiple carrier portals, the software gives you a single place to see the status of every shipment, manage costs, and respond quickly to exceptions.

Freight Management Software vs. Transportation Management System (TMS)

These terms are often used interchangeably, but there are subtle differences. A Transportation Management System (TMS) is typically broader and may cover more advanced planning, optimization, and carrier contract management functions. Freight management software can be a component of a TMS or a focused solution for freight-specific tasks like rate comparison and documentation.

If you’re assessing options, clarify whether a vendor offers a full TMS, a freight-focused module, or a carrier-facing platform. That will influence the scope, integrations, and price.

Core Functions and Features

Freight management software includes a range of features that reduce manual work and improve efficiency. These functions handle everything from quoting to settlement, often in real time.

  • Shipment planning and routing: You can create optimized routes based on cost, transit time, service level, and special handling requirements.
  • Rate management and comparison: The system stores negotiated rates, spot rates, and accessorial charges so you can compare carrier options instantly.
  • Carrier selection and tendering: You can automate carrier selection and send shipment tenders via EDI, API, or email.
  • Tracking and visibility: Real-time status updates and geofencing alerts let you monitor progress and respond to delays.
  • Documentation and compliance: Bill of lading, customs paperwork, hazardous materials documentation, and other paperwork are generated and stored digitally.
  • Audit and claims: The software flags billing anomalies, automates freight audits, and manages claims workflow.
  • Billing and settlement: You can consolidate invoices, automate payment approvals, and reconcile charges against contracts.
  • Analytics and reporting: Dashboards and reports help you track KPIs like on-time delivery, cost per shipment, carrier performance, and carbon footprint.
  • Integration capabilities: APIs and EDI support let you connect to ERPs, WMS, e-commerce platforms, and carrier systems.
  • Automation and rules engine: Business rules automate routing, carrier selection, and exception handling.
  • Mobile access: Mobile apps or responsive web portals enable drivers, warehouse staff, and managers to update statuses from the field.

Types of Freight Management Software

There are several categories you’ll encounter when evaluating solutions. Each type suits different company sizes and operational complexity.

  • Cloud-based TMS/FMS: Hosted by the vendor, updated regularly, and accessible from anywhere. Great if you want scalability without heavy IT investment.
  • On-premises TMS: Installed on your servers, offering more control but requiring more IT resources and longer upgrade cycles.
  • Carrier portals and marketplaces: Aggregators that connect you to multiple carriers for instant booking. Usually best for businesses that need rapid spot-rate access.
  • 3PL platforms: Software provided by third-party logistics providers that combines their operational services with technology for a more hands-off approach.
  • Vertical-specific solutions: Platforms built for industries like retail, automotive, or cold chain, with specialized features for those needs.

How Freight Management Software Works — The Typical Workflow

Understanding the workflow helps you see where automation replaces manual steps and where visibility improves decision-making.

  1. Order capture: The shipment details come from your ERP, WMS, or order management system.
  2. Rating & routing: The FMS compares carrier rates and suggests optimized routes based on cost, transit time, and service-level rules.
  3. Carrier tendering: The software automatically sends the shipment tender to the selected carrier and captures confirmation.
  4. Documentation: BOLs, labels, and customs forms are generated and shared with stakeholders.
  5. Pickup & tracking: Real-time status updates from carriers and telematics are aggregated within the system.
  6. Exception handling: Alerts are triggered for delays, route changes, or damages. Rules and workflows route exceptions to the right person.
  7. Delivery & proof of delivery (POD): Completed deliveries and POD documents are captured and stored.
  8. Audit & settlement: Invoices are matched against contracted rates and shipment records, and discrepancies are flagged for claim.
  9. Reporting & continuous improvement: Analytics help you identify carrier performance issues and opportunities for cost reduction.

Benefits You’ll See From Using FMS

Implementing freight management software produces measurable improvements across cost, service, and productivity.

  • Lower transportation costs: Rate optimization, carrier selection, and audit automation reduce freight spend and recover overcharges.
  • Improved transit times and reliability: Better route planning and carrier performance tracking help you maintain service levels.
  • Reduced manual overhead: Automation frees your team from repetitive tasks so they can focus on strategic activities.
  • Better customer experience: Accurate ETAs, real-time tracking, and faster issue resolution increase customer satisfaction.
  • Enhanced compliance and reduced risk: Digital documentation and automated screening reduce regulatory and customs errors.
  • Scalable processes: As shipment volumes grow, software scales without a linear increase in headcount.
  • Transparency and insights: Dashboards and reports let you measure and manage what matters most.

Selecting the Right Freight Management Software

Choosing the right solution requires careful evaluation. You should align the software to your business goals, data systems, and operational realities.

  • Define your objectives: Are you focused on cost savings, visibility, compliance, or growth support?
  • Map your processes: Know where shipments originate, how carriers are selected, and which systems must integrate.
  • Prioritize must-have features: Identify absolute requirements (e.g., customs integration for international shipments).
  • Consider future needs: Look for scalability, multi-modal support, and the ability to add modules later.
  • Check integrations: Ensure the software connects to your ERP, WMS, e-commerce platforms, and preferred carriers.
  • Review total cost of ownership: Factor software licenses, implementation, training, and ongoing support.
  • Trial and pilot: Run a pilot with a subset of shipments to measure real-world performance and ROI.

Implementation Best Practices

A successful rollout depends on planning, data integrity, and user adoption. These steps will help you implement more smoothly.

  • Assign a cross-functional team: Include operations, IT, finance, compliance, and customer service.
  • Define clear project goals and milestones: Make success measurable with KPIs like cost per shipment or percentage of automated tenders.
  • Clean and standardize data: Accurate addresses, product classifications, and carrier contracts are critical for automation.
  • Integrate with core systems early: ERP and WMS integrations prevent double-entry and improve visibility.
  • Start with a pilot: Use a single lane or product family to validate processes and refine settings.
  • Train users and create documentation: Provide role-specific training and quick-reference guides to boost adoption.
  • Monitor and iterate: Use early metrics to adjust rules, optimize carriers, and refine workflows.

Integration with Carriers and Partners

Seamless carrier integration is a cornerstone of effective freight management. The more carriers and partners you connect, the less manual intervention you’ll need.

  • EDI vs. API: EDI is widely used in legacy carrier systems, while APIs offer real-time, flexible integrations with modern carriers and trucking networks.
  • Telematics & IoT: Connecting to fleet telematics gives you more granular tracking and ETA accuracy.
  • 3PL integration: If you use third-party logistics providers, ensure your FMS connects to their platforms for order handoffs and status updates.
  • Customs and broker integrations: For cross-border shipments, integrated customs brokers speed clearance and reduce delays.

Audit, Claims, and Financial Controls

Freight audit and claims management is an area where FMS produces direct ROI. The software automates invoice matching, flags discrepancies, and manages claim workflows so you get credit for carrier errors or service failures.

  • Automated matching: The system compares invoices with contracted rates and shipment logs.
  • Exception routing: Discrepancies are routed to the right person with evidence for faster resolution.
  • Claims templates and tracking: You can store communications, upload supporting documents, and monitor recovery status.
  • Financial reconciliation: Integration with your AP/ERP streamlines payment and ensures you only pay correct amounts.

Security and Compliance

You must protect shipment data and comply with regulations. Freight management software should include strong security controls and compliance features.

  • Data security: Look for encryption in transit and at rest, role-based access controls, and comprehensive audit logs.
  • Regulatory compliance: The system should support customs filing, export compliance screening, and hazardous-materials handling rules.
  • Privacy: Vendor policies should comply with applicable data privacy laws (e.g., GDPR if you operate in Europe).
  • Disaster recovery: Verify backup and failover procedures to ensure continuity during outages.

International Shipping Considerations

If you ship internationally, freight management software becomes even more valuable. It helps you handle customs, duties, documentation, and multi-leg routing.

  • Customs documentation: Automated generation of commercial invoices, ISF, and other required paperwork speeds clearance.
  • Duties and taxes: Platforms often provide landed cost calculations so you can identify total landed cost before shipping.
  • Incoterms and responsibilities: The system can manage Incoterm rules and who pays for which leg of transport.
  • Carrier and mode selection: Optimize for air, ocean, or intermodal shipments based on cost and transit priorities.
  • Trade compliance: Integration with denied-party screening and export controls reduces legal risk.

Overcoming Common Challenges

Even with powerful software, some challenges can slow progress. Knowing how to handle them helps you move faster.

  • Data quality issues: Clean and standardize your master data before going live to reduce exceptions.
  • Resistance to change: Provide strong training, show quick wins, and involve users in configuration decisions.
  • Integration complexity: Prioritize integrations that unblock core operations and phase others in later.
  • Carrier adoption: Work with carriers to enable EDI or API connectivity, and use portals as a temporary bridge.
  • Customization overload: Avoid excessive customization that complicates upgrades; prefer configurable workflows.

Future Trends to Watch

Freight management software continues to evolve, and these trends will shape how you manage logistics going forward.

  • AI and machine learning: These technologies will improve ETA predictions, dynamic routing, and anomaly detection for invoices and carrier behavior.
  • Blockchain for provenance: Secure, decentralized ledgers may improve transparency for high-value and regulated shipments, particularly in international trade.
  • Increased automation at the edge: Autonomous vehicles, drones, and robotic handling will introduce new integration points for FMS platforms.
  • Sustainability tracking: Carbon accounting and optimization for low-emission modes will become standard KPI inputs.
  • Greater API adoption: Real-time API connectivity with carriers, brokers, and telematics services will replace legacy EDI in many lanes.
